--NVIM-CONFIG--
-- SETTINGS ---
vim.g.mapleader = " " -- Leader
vim.g.netrw_keepdir = 0
vim.g.netrw_liststyle = 1 -- wide style with ls
vim.g.netrw_banner = 0
vim.g.netrw_special_syntax = true
vim.opt.splitbelow = true -- Keeps the below window when splitting or quiting
vim.opt.equalalways = false -- Does not make windows equal automatically
vim.opt.tabstop = 4 -- Tabs and shift
vim.opt.expandtab = true
vim.opt.shiftwidth = 4
vim.opt.smartindent = true -- Indents
vim.opt.wrap = false -- Wrap
vim.opt.number = true -- Line numbers
vim.opt.relativenumber = true
vim.opt.incsearch = true
vim.opt.swapfile = false
vim.opt.undofile = true
vim.opt.termguicolors = true -- Nice term colours
vim.opt.cursorline = true -- Cursor highlight line
vim.opt.signcolumn = "yes" -- Sign column next to lines
vim.opt.scrolloff = 10
vim.opt.winborder= "rounded"
vim.opt.path:append{"**"} -- Use :find for all subdirectories
vim.opt.completeopt = { "menuone", "noselect", "popup", "fuzzy" }
vim.opt.wildoptions:append{"fuzzy"} -- Fuzzy wild menu
vim.opt.foldenable = false
vim.opt.foldcolumn = '0'
vim.opt.foldtext = " "
vim.opt.foldmethod = "indent"
vim.opt.foldlevel = 99
-- Check this issue to see if pwsh can finally be used with :te and no :te pwsh, https://github.com/neovim/neovim/issues/31494
vim.opt.shell = 'pwsh'
vim.opt.shellcmdflag = "-NoLogo -NoProfile -NonInteractive -ExecutionPolicy RemoteSigned -Command [Console]::InputEncoding=[Console]::OutputEncoding=[System.Text.Encoding]::UTF8;$PSDefaultParameterValues['Out-File:Encoding']='utf8';$PSStyle.OutputRendering = 'PlainText';";
vim.opt.shellpipe = '> %s 2>&1'
vim.opt.shellxquote = ''
vim.opt.shellquote = ''
vim.opt.shelltemp = false
vim.env.__SuppressAnsiEscapeSequences=1
vim.cmd('colorscheme nanos') -- Colourscheme
--END-SETTINGS---
--REMAPS--
vim.keymap.set("n", "<C-i>", "gg=G``", {desc = "Auto-indent and go back to position"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"<leader>re", ":%s/<C-R><C-W>/", {desc = "Shortcut to replace current word under cursor"})
vim.keymap.set("t", "<ESC>", "<C-\\><C-n>", {desc = "Escape the terminal and go back to normal mode"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"<leader>o", ":Explore .<CR>", {desc = "Netrw explore from cwd"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"<leader>O", ":Explore <CR>", {desc= "Netrw explore from file directory"})
vim.keymap.set({"n", "v"}, "<leader>p", [["+p]], {desc = "Paste from system clipboard"})
vim.keymap.set({"n", "v"}, "<leader>y", [["+y]], {desc = "Copy to system clipboard"})
vim.keymap.set("v", "J", ":m '>+1<CR>gv=gv", {desc = "Move a selection down"})
vim.keymap.set("v", "K", ":m '<-2<CR>gv=gv", {desc = "Move a selection up"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"J", "mzJ`z", {desc = "Append line and cursor remains in the same place"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"n", "nzzzv", {desc = "Keep cursor in the middle when searching"})
vim.keymap.set("n", "N", "Nzzzv", {desc = "Keep cursor in the middle when searching"})
vim.keymap.set("v", "<", "<gv", { desc = "Indent left and reselect" })
vim.keymap.set("v", ">", ">gv", { desc = "Indent right and reselect" })
vim.keymap.set("n", "<C-Up>", ":resize +2<CR>", { desc = "Increase window height" })
vim.keymap.set("n", "<C-Down>", ":resize -2<CR>", { desc = "Decrease window height" })
vim.keymap.set("n", "<C-Left>", ":vertical resize -2<CR>", { desc = "Decrease window width" })
vim.keymap.set("n", "<C-Right>", ":vertical resize +2<CR>", { desc = "Increase window width" })
--END-REMAPS--

--AUTOCOMMANDS--
local config_augroup = vim.api.nvim_create_augroup("Config", { clear = true })
-- Builtin LSP autocompletion
-- From https://www.reddit.com/r/neovim/comments/1mhusus/comment/n733xp9
v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("LspAttach", {
group = config_augroup,
callback = function(ev)
local client = vim.lsp.get_client_by_id(ev.data.client_id)
if not client then return end
-- Autocompletion
if client:supports_method("textDocument/completion") then
-- These three lines here are for auto-triggering on any keypress, I am unsure if I want this or not
-- local chars = {}
-- for i = 32, 126 do table.insert(chars, string.char(i)) end
-- client.server_capabilities.completionProvider.triggerCharacters = chars
vim.lsp.completion.enable( true, client.id, ev.buf,
{
autotrigger = true,
convert = function(item)
local abbr = item.label
abbr = #abbr > 30 and abbr:sub(1, 29) .. "…" or abbr
local menu = item.detail or ""
menu = #menu > 30 and menu:sub(1, 29) .. "…" or menu
return { abbr = abbr, menu = menu }
end
})
end
-- Documentation formatting when using auto-completion
if client:supports_method("completionItem/resolve") then
local _, cancel_prev = nil, function() end
v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("CompleteChanged", {
group = config_augroup,
buffer = ev.buf,
callback = function(event)
cancel_prev()
local info = vim.fn.complete_info({ "selected" })
local completionItem = vim.tbl_get(vim.v.completed_item, "user_data", "nvim", "lsp", "completion_item")
if not completionItem then return end
cancel_prev = vim.lsp.buf_request_all( event.buf, vim.lsp.protocol.Methods.completionItem_resolve, completionItem,
function(results)
if not results then return end
for _, v in ipairs(results) do
local item = v.result
local docs = (item.documentation or {}).value
local win = vim.api.nvim__complete_set(info["selected"], { info = docs })
if win.winid and vim.api.nvim_win_is_valid(win.winid) then
vim.treesitter.start(win.bufnr, item.documentation.kind)
vim.wo[win.winid].conceallevel = 3
end
end
end)
end,
})
end
end
})
-- From https://github.com/nvim-treesitter/nvim-treesitter/issues/8221#issuecomment-3436658280
v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("FileType", {
group = config_augroup,
callback = function(args)
local treesitter = require('nvim-treesitter')
local lang = vim.treesitter.language.get_lang(args.match)
if vim.list_contains(treesitter.get_available(), lang) then
if not vim.list_contains(treesitter.get_installed(), lang) then
treesitter.install(lang):wait()
end
vim.treesitter.start(args.buf)
end
end,
desc = "Enable nvim-treesitter and install parser if not installed"
})
v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("WinEnter", {
pattern = { "*" },
group = config_augroup,
callback = function()
vim.fn.matchadd("TODO", 'TODO:')
vim.fn.matchadd("INFO", 'INFO:')
vim.fn.matchadd("FIX", 'FIX:')
vim.fn.matchadd("BUG", 'BUG:')
end,
desc = "Make the matches for the nanos colorscheme Special Comments at every window"
})
v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d({ 'VimLeavePre' }, {
group = config_augroup,
pattern = { '*' },
callback = function()
local status = 0
for _, f in ipairs(vim.fn.globpath(vim.fn.stdpath('data') .. '/shada', '*tmp*', false, true)) do
if vim.tbl_isempty(vim.fn.readfile(f)) then
status = status + vim.fn.delete(f)
end
end
if status ~= 0 then
vim.notify('Could not delete empty temporary ShaDa files.', vim.log.levels.ERROR)
vim.fn.getchar()
end
end,
desc = "Delete empty temp ShaDa files"
})
--END-AUTOCOMMANDS--
--COMMANDS--
vim.api.nvim_create_user_command('DeleteInactiveBuffers', function()
local notify = false
local number = 0
for _, buf in ipairs(vim.fn.getbufinfo()) do
if vim.tbl_isempty(buf.windows) and buf.listed == 1 and buf.changed == 0 then
notify = true
number = number + 1
vim.cmd.bdelete({ buf.bufnr, bang = true })
end
end
if notify then
vim.notify('Deleted ' .. tostring(number) .. ' inactive buffer(s).', vim.log.levels.INFO)
else
vim.notify('No inactive buffers were deleted.', vim.log.levels.INFO)
end
end,
{ desc = 'Delete listed unmodified buffers that are not in a window' })
vim.api.nvim_create_user_command('InsertLastMessage', function()
local messages = vim.split(vim.fn.execute('messages'), "\n")
vim.api.nvim_put({messages[#messages]}, "c", false, false)
end,
{ desc = 'Insert the last message from :messages' })
-- From https://www.reddit.com/r/neovim/comments/1qb0qbf/i_replaced_whichkey_plugin_with_basic_lua_script/
vim.api.nvim_create_user_command('ListCustomKeymaps', function()
local keymaps = vim.api.nvim_exec2("verbose map", { output = true }).output
local lines = vim.split(keymaps, "\n")
local buff = vim.api.nvim_create_buf(true, true)
vim.api.nvim_set_current_buf(buff)
vim.api.nvim_buf_set_lines(buff, 0, -1, false, lines)
end,
{ desc = 'List keymaps' })
--END-COMMANDS--
